黑狐家游戏

oracle的数据备份和还原命令,oracle数据备份和还原系统实现论文,基于Oracle数据库的自动化备份与还原系统设计与实现

欧气 0 0
本论文探讨了Oracle数据库的自动化备份与还原系统设计与实现。详细介绍了Oracle数据备份和还原的命令,以及如何通过系统实现高效的数据备份和还原,确保数据库安全与稳定。

本文目录导读:

  1. 系统需求分析
  2. 系统设计
  3. 系统实现
  4. 系统测试与评估

随着信息技术的飞速发展,数据库作为企业核心资产,其数据的完整性和安全性日益受到重视,Oracle数据库作为全球最流行的关系型数据库之一,其数据备份与还原机制是实现数据安全的关键,本文旨在设计并实现一套基于Oracle数据库的自动化备份与还原系统,以提高数据安全性、降低运维成本,并确保数据在故障发生时能够迅速恢复。

系统需求分析

1、1 数据备份需求

(1)定时备份:系统应支持定时自动备份,确保数据不因操作失误而丢失。

oracle的数据备份和还原命令,oracle数据备份和还原系统实现论文,基于Oracle数据库的自动化备份与还原系统设计与实现

图片来源于网络,如有侵权联系删除

(2)增量备份:系统应支持增量备份,降低备份时间与空间占用。

(3)全量备份:系统应支持全量备份,确保数据在故障发生时能够完全恢复。

1、2 数据还原需求

(1)快速还原:系统应支持快速还原,缩短故障恢复时间。

(2)选择性还原:系统应支持按时间点或数据范围进行选择性还原。

(3)数据一致性检查:系统应支持数据一致性检查,确保还原后的数据准确无误。

系统设计

2、1 系统架构

本系统采用分层架构,包括数据层、业务逻辑层和表现层。

(1)数据层:负责与Oracle数据库交互,实现数据的备份与还原。

(2)业务逻辑层:负责处理备份与还原业务,包括定时任务、增量备份、全量备份、选择性还原等。

(3)表现层:负责与用户交互,提供友好的界面和操作流程。

2、2 关键技术

oracle的数据备份和还原命令,oracle数据备份和还原系统实现论文,基于Oracle数据库的自动化备份与还原系统设计与实现

图片来源于网络,如有侵权联系删除

(1)Oracle RMAN备份:采用Oracle RMAN进行数据备份,提高备份效率。

(2)Oracle Data Pump:采用Oracle Data Pump进行数据还原,确保数据一致性。

(3)定时任务:利用cron定时任务实现定时备份。

(4)脚本编程:采用Shell、Python等脚本语言编写备份与还原脚本。

系统实现

3、1 数据备份实现

(1)全量备份:利用Oracle RMAN创建全量备份,并存储在指定的备份目录。

(2)增量备份:利用Oracle RMAN创建增量备份,并存储在指定的备份目录。

(3)定时备份:利用cron定时任务,调用备份脚本,实现定时备份。

3、2 数据还原实现

(1)选择性还原:根据用户输入的时间点或数据范围,调用Oracle Data Pump进行选择性还原。

(2)快速还原:利用Oracle RMAN进行快速还原,提高还原效率。

(3)数据一致性检查:在还原完成后,对还原后的数据进行一致性检查,确保数据准确无误。

oracle的数据备份和还原命令,oracle数据备份和还原系统实现论文,基于Oracle数据库的自动化备份与还原系统设计与实现

图片来源于网络,如有侵权联系删除

系统测试与评估

4、1 测试方法

(1)功能测试:验证系统各项功能是否按预期实现。

(2)性能测试:测试系统在不同负载下的性能表现。

(3)稳定性测试:测试系统在长时间运行下的稳定性。

4、2 测试结果

(1)功能测试:系统各项功能均按预期实现,包括定时备份、增量备份、全量备份、选择性还原等。

(2)性能测试:系统在不同负载下表现稳定,备份与还原效率较高。

(3)稳定性测试:系统在长时间运行下表现稳定,无异常情况发生。

本文设计并实现了一套基于Oracle数据库的自动化备份与还原系统,通过RMAN和Data Pump等技术,实现了数据的定时备份、增量备份、全量备份和选择性还原等功能,系统经过测试,性能稳定,能够满足企业对数据安全性的需求,在实际应用中,该系统可降低运维成本,提高数据安全性,确保数据在故障发生时能够迅速恢复。

黑狐家游戏
  • 评论列表

留言评论